Distributed Systems Jobs in England

1 to 25 of 111 Distributed Systems Jobs in England

Python Developer/Lead - Itential IAG - IAP - API - Data - Kafka

Ipswich, England, United Kingdom
We Are Orbis Group Ltd
and Python Development Network Automation Tools: Deep knowledge in using Itential IAG and IAP, and Juniper Paragon Suite for network automation. API Development and Systems Integration: Experienced with RESTful, gRPC APIs, and JSON/Protobuf; familiar with designing and managing APIs using platforms like Kong API. Container Orchestration and … Distributed Systems: Expertise in Kubernetes for orchestrating containerized applications and troubleshooting distributed systems. Monitoring and Data Analysis Operational Automation Datamodelling and Configuration Management Open-source Engagement and CICD Methodologies Python Developer/Lead - Itential IAG - IAP - API - Data - Kafka - Contract - Ipswich/Remote - Inside IR35 ... more »
Posted:

Senior C# Software Engineer - Hedge Fund

London, England, United Kingdom
Hybrid / WFH Options
Client Server
users to build the solutions they need, working end-to-end across the full development lifecycle. Typically, you'll be analysing the current monolith systems, making strategic technology recommendations for improvements and helping to deliver a long term strategic project to re-engineer the data analytics platform using modern … technologies such as .Net Core, microservices and distributed systems engineering. Location/WFH Policy: You'll join a small group of accomplished entrepreneurs with flexibility to work from home most of the time, meeting up with the team in North London on Thursdays. About you: You have advanced … C# .Net development skills You have a good working knowledge and experience with microservices, distributed systems engineering, Azure Cloud infrastructure You have a good understanding of modern SQL database solutions You have experience of working on financial/trading systems You have experience of working in small more »
Posted:

Lead Software Engineer - C# / .Net

London Area, United Kingdom
Hybrid / WFH Options
KPMG UK
it? Be a subject matter expert in full stack engineering using C#/.Net5+ and Angular 2+ framework. Demonstrable experience leading engineering teams building distributed systems and secure products at scale. Have a solid understanding of design practices, system architecture and conducting code reviews. Experience building applications for more »
Posted:

Software Engineer

London Area, United Kingdom
GCS
Rust, or significant experience in C/C++/C#/Java/Go with a keen interest in learning Rust. Experience in building systems for data processing or other latency-sensitive applications. Proficiency in writing high-performance multi-threaded code. Experience in developing scalable distributed systems. Strong … familiarity with concurrency and object-oriented programming principles. Understanding of database systems and basic SQL queries. Comfortable working with Linux/Unix, AWS, Git, Docker. Understanding how the Ethereum Virtual Machine (EVM) works. Well-versed in blockchain fundamentals, the transaction supply chain, and Maximal Extractable Value (MEV). Why more »
Posted:

Staff Software Engineer (Insights)

London, England, United Kingdom
Bazaarvoice
of Bazaarvoice data that will power our various client-facing dashboards, raw data reporting, product performance reporting. The ideal candidate has built and operated systems that aggregate and share data sets to support new product offerings and is well experienced in evaluating the right technologies to build those data … data. Define how data should be aggregated and made available to other consuming applications while maintaining high availability and performance. Implementation of the mechanism, systems, and software to make it happen. Use your strong grasp of the technology stack to guide where we go next. Drive engineering best practices … and help mentor talent. Who You Are 7+ years of experience building and supporting scalable, distributed systems using open-source tools. Proven hands-on experience with Object Oriented programming languages and with at least 1 scripting language (ex. Java/C++/etc. and Python/Ruby/ more »
Posted:

Lead Data Engineer

Greater London, England, United Kingdom
OpenCredo
or leading a team. You understand core data & architectural principles, yet always seek to blend and balance real world considerations with pure theoretical approaches. Distributed Systems Experience: You have developed and worked with Big data architectures including delivering event driven solutions. You are aware of the fallacies of … distributed computing and how this impacts and relates to complex data platforms and storage solutions. Innovation & Continuous Learning: You enjoy and actively seek to learn about new technologies and techniques in the Data and AI/ML space. You are an advocate for promoting and incorporating best practices around more »
Posted:

Hedge Fund Quant Developer - Pricing Engineer

London Area, United Kingdom
Morgan McKinley
Experience with modern C++ Highly Proficient at programming in Python Experience using front-office pricing libraries Comfortable with relational and timeseries databases Exposure to distributed systems and messaging (e.g. Kafka) Comfortable with Numpy, Pandas and Jupyter Highly self-motivated, willing to take initiative and make technical decisions more »
Posted:

Software Engineer

Cambridge, England, United Kingdom
Hybrid / WFH Options
Intrasonics, an Ipsos Company
trying to improve its workflow, and we are not afraid of investing in new ideas. If you like to design, develop, and deploy resilient distributed systems you will fit right in. You will have the chance to work on established projects, kickstart new ones, and make a case … working with databases (e.g. MySQL, PostgreSQL, MSSQL, or MongoDB) Familiarity with front-end technologies such as HTML, CSS, and JavaScript. Experience with version control systems (e.g. Git, or SVN) Familiarity with Agile development methodologies An ability to produce clear, informative supporting documentation. Desirable Skills Comfortable with Unix core command …/project tracking software, e.g. Jira Knowledge of container and orchestration technologies (e.g. Docker, Kubernetes, LXC) Other technologies associated with multi-tier architectures, and distributed computing. E.g. Redis, RabbitMQ, Prometheus, Apache Kafka, ELK, load balancers, ... What is in it for me? Ipsos UK offer an attractive basic salary more »
Posted:

Software Engineer - Algorithmic Trading - Realtime Analytics

London Area, United Kingdom
Orbis Group
an elite level Software Engineer with real-time analytics experience to own and manage the mission control panel for one of the largest trading systems in the world, running between $250-$300 billion USD daily! You’ll be responsible for enhancing the performance of this trading system and have … and developers to understand needs and deliver effective solutions. Ensure data accuracy and clarity for informed decision-making across the organization. Build robust, reliable systems that can handle high volumes and 24/7 operation. You'll be a great fit if you have: Strong communication skills to collaborate … with diverse teams. Proficiency in a statically typed language (Kotlin preferred). Algorithmic problem-solving skills and ability to write efficient code. Experience with distributed systems and automated testing. Relevant degree from a world leading university. Passion for reducing complexity and ensuring correctness. A plus if you have more »
Posted:

Staff Software Engineer (Front-End)

Birmingham, England, United Kingdom
BlackLine
Azure, and Amazon Web Services. You will be responsible for designing and building components that enhance the configurability, extensibility, and interoperability of these various systems and the customer systems to which they connect, while striving for usability and scalability of data transfer using a full breadth of design … available within each system. Provide technical expertise and leadership in requirements analysis, design, effort estimation, development, testing and delivery of highly scalable and secure distributed backend services. Mentor and coach team members, guide them to solutions on complex design issues and do peer code reviews. Work with product management … extensibility through OO patterns, plugins, external callouts, events and notifications. Experience as a technical lead for design, architecture and code review of highly scalable distributed systems and event driven architecture. Fluent in SQL, No-SQL, data modeling and transactional flows. Superior analytical, problem-solving and system level performance more »
Posted:

Software Engineer - Java - Fully Remote

London Area, United Kingdom
Hybrid / WFH Options
Selby Jennings
looking for a Software Engineer with over 5 years of experience, exceptional proficiency in core Java, and significant experience in low latency, high throughput distributed systems. The successful candidate will work on high frequency, low latency trading systems, alongside order management and pre- and post-trade risk management … systems. Responsibilities: Develop and maintain high-frequency trading infrastructure, including order management systems, pre- and post-trade risk management systems, and liquidity venue connectors. Optimize latency and throughput for trading systems. Implement automated market-neutral strategies, combining on-chain and off-chain methods for mid to high-frequency … Over 5 years of back-end engineering experience. Advanced proficiency in Java or another JVM language. Strong expertise in building low latency, high throughput distributed systems. Experience with trading strategies and latency-sensitive components of trading systems, such as exchange integration, order management systems, market data, and more »
Posted:

Infrastructure & Network Manager

Peterborough, England, United Kingdom
CDW UK
the CDW network and that appropriate response mechanisms exist to address any given incident. Design robust, highly available, high performance network infrastructure involving multiple distributed systems (including data centre, LAN/WAN/WLAN/SDWAN, Internet, Load Balancers, Firewalls and Network Management Platforms). Experience deploying and … SAN, HPE technologies, Windows, Red Hat Server OS, Citrix and SQL environment). Specific responsibilities include installation, configuration, administration, upgrade, and maintenance of complex systems, auditing and change management. Support escalation of incidents as they occur out of hours. Maximize performance by monitoring infrastructure; troubleshooting interruption/loss of more »
Posted:

Lead Software Engineer

Southampton, England, United Kingdom
Langham Recruitment
senior/lead Experienced with Python Backend API implementation (eg. REST and GraphQL) Experience with a Cloud platform Relational databases Microservices architecture Proficiency with distributed systems thinking, consensus protocols, and writing fault tolerant applications Experience of DevOps practices Experience working with infrastructure as code Bonus: Experience with 3D more »
Posted:

Software Developer

Newcastle Upon Tyne, Tyne and Wear, North East, United Kingdom
Opencast Software Europe Ltd
and speed. Strong analytical and problem solving skills, capable of tackling complex technical challenges. Experience in handling large scale data processing and working with distributed systems. In depth knowledge of parallelism, threading, and concurrent programming, with practical experience in these areas. Proven ability to build high performing, low latency more »
Employment Type: Permanent
Salary: £95,000
Posted:

Principal C# Engineer - Greenfield Trading System - London

London, United Kingdom
Vertus Partners
all asset classes across the business. Candidates will need to come from a strong C# background with demonstrable experience building and delivering into production distributed systems that are highly performant, available and recoverable. You will also become an integral part of a collaborative community that supports continuous learning … a market-leading remuneration and benefits package. Successful candidates will have experience in the below areas: Expert level C# development skills. Experience working on distributed systems. Extensive expertise in designing high-availability systems with swift and accurate recovery. Experience with Kafka (or alternative messaging systems). Proficient more »
Employment Type: Permanent
Salary: GBP 200,000 Annual
Posted:

Software Engineer

South West London, London, United Kingdom
Networking People (UK) Limited
together with other leaders in the field. The ideal profiles would be for a senior and a mid-level engineer with a background in distributed systems (Senior - 10-20 years/Mid Level -5-10 years). Work on building Virtual Machine offering as part of the Compute … team. Ideal background is someone who has virtual machines or virtual networking experience but open to consider all strong engineers with a background in distributed systems. Technical Knowledge Required: Strong background in distributed systems and Linux systems engineering Coding in programming languages such as C, C++ … automation, such as Terraform, Ansible, or Helm. Active engagement or contributions to the open-source community. Familiarity with software build processes and secure supply systems, like Bazel or OpenSSF. The role You will have an opportunity to team up with fellow engineers to craft tailored solutions meeting their unique more »
Employment Type: Permanent
Salary: £85,000
Posted:

Senior Backend Engineer

Central London, London, United Kingdom
Hybrid / WFH Options
TMW Unlimited
enthusiastic and experienced Senior Backend Engineer. Youll be passionate about leveraging the principles of Composable MACH architecture to design, develop, and maintain robust backend systems that blow peoples socks off. Were looking for you to: Be comfortable with MVC, Microservices, APIs, Headless CMSs and be familiar with associated front … solutions, integrate with various services and APIs, and ensure the reliability and performance of our digital platforms. Design, develop, test and deploy scalable backend systems following the principles of Composable MACH architecture. Implement RESTful APIs and microservices using modern programming languages and frameworks such as C#, Node.js, Python, or … knowledge of handwritten C#, .Net and JavaScript. Ideally, youll have a relevant qualification in Computer Science, Engineering, or equivalent commercial experience. Comfortable with Devops, Systems administrations and AWS/Azure. Strive for a high degree of automation, clean architecture, and high quality with a customer-centric mindset. Commercial experience more »
Employment Type: Permanent, Work From Home
Salary: £70,000
Posted:

Senior Software Developer

South West London, London, United Kingdom
Networking People (UK) Limited
together with other leaders in the field. The ideal profiles would be for a senior and a mid-level engineer with a background in distributed systems (Senior - 10-20 years/Mid Level -5-10 years). Work on building Virtual Machine offering as part of the Compute … team. Ideal background is someone who has virtual machines or virtual networking experience but open to consider all strong engineers with a background in distributed systems. Technical Knowledge Required: Strong background in distributed systems and Linux systems engineering Coding in programming languages such as C, C++ … automation, such as Terraform, Ansible, or Helm. Active engagement or contributions to the open-source community. Familiarity with software build processes and secure supply systems, like Bazel or OpenSSF. The role You will have an opportunity to team up with fellow engineers to craft tailored solutions meeting their unique more »
Employment Type: Permanent
Salary: £85,000
Posted:

PLATFORM ENGINEER

Manchester, North West, United Kingdom
Peregrine
key and instrumental function to support and deliver cloud migration programmes across the organisation. This team engineers, design, build and maintains the delivery infrastructure, systems and processes underpinning technology transformation engagements and lead the adoption of modern platforms and ways of working. In this role, you will need to … Terraform. Deep understanding of CI/CD pipeline Code Repository Management (e.g. Gitlab, GitHub, Bitbucket) Architecture awareness and experience around enterprise scale applications and distributed systems Has a DevOps mind-set towards Automation. Understanding of Security Compliance PCI DSS, ISO, Cyber Essentials, NIST. Platform Engineer more »
Employment Type: Permanent
Posted:

Senior Software Engineer

Central London, London, United Kingdom
Hybrid / WFH Options
TMW Unlimited
enthusiastic and experienced Senior Backend Engineer. Youll be passionate about leveraging the principles of Composable MACH architecture to design, develop, and maintain robust backend systems that blow peoples socks off. Were looking for you to: Be comfortable with MVC, Microservices, APIs, Headless CMSs and be familiar with associated front … solutions, integrate with various services and APIs, and ensure the reliability and performance of our digital platforms. Design, develop, test and deploy scalable backend systems following the principles of Composable MACH architecture. Implement RESTful APIs and microservices using modern programming languages and frameworks such as C#, Node.js, Python, or … knowledge of handwritten C#, .Net and JavaScript. Ideally, youll have a relevant qualification in Computer Science, Engineering, or equivalent commercial experience. Comfortable with Devops, Systems administrations and AWS/Azure. Strive for a high degree of automation, clean architecture, and high quality with a customer-centric mindset. Commercial experience more »
Employment Type: Permanent, Work From Home
Salary: £70,000
Posted:

Senior Software Engineer, Technical Lead

South West London, London, United Kingdom
Networking People (UK) Limited
the codebase, drive the direction of future product development and collaborate closely together with other leaders in the field. Technical Knowledge Required: Proficiency in distributed systems and Linux systems engineering. Coding in programming languages such as C, C++, Golang or Rust. Experience working with and/or more »
Employment Type: Permanent
Posted:

Senior Elixir Developer

Bristol, Avon, South West, United Kingdom
ZENOVO LTD
technology ranging from infrastructure and operations to data architectures. Experience of modern web technologies, with rapid deploy, automated scaling, and high volume, high availability distributed systems. In depth experience of engineering delivery at scale with a demonstrable track record of outstanding results. more »
Employment Type: Permanent
Salary: £80,000
Posted:

Head of Business Systems

Goole, East Riding, North East, United Kingdom
Hybrid / WFH Options
Tunstall Healthcare (UK) Ltd
We are recruiting a Head of Business Systems to join our Team based in the UK (Manchester City Centre or Whitley (DN14 0HR)). We offer a hybrid working pattern with a mix of office and remote working. What will you be doing in this role? As Head of … Business Systems, you will be a crucial member of the Technical Operations Leadership Team, overseeing our business applications services portfolio across the group. The Ideal candidate: We're looking for someone with experience of working with a wide range of stakeholders across multiple regions (mainly Europe), overseeing our business … applications services portfolio across the group. Ideally you will have significant experience in IT systems, technical leadership and digital transformation. Key skills and experience: Proven experience in a technical senior leadership role managing enterprise systems, technology professionals and related vendor relationships. Demonstrable experience of owning, operating and delivering more »
Employment Type: Permanent, Work From Home
Posted:

Senior Software Engineer

Greater London, England, United Kingdom
Burns Sheehan
Senior Software Engineer | Distributed Systems | Sustainable Cloud Native Platform 💸Up to £100,000 per annum plus bonus plus stock 🏠Central London office 🖱️Golang, Rust, C, Kubernetes, Linux, Cloud Native, Distributed systems... Are you a Senior Software Engineer with extensive knowledge of building distributed systems? Looking … looking for in a Senior Software Engineer: Tech agnostic but preferable experience working with Golang, Rust or C/C++. In-depth knowledge of distributed systems, building solutions at scale where performance, reliability and availability are key considerations. Experience working on software infrastructure or building Cloud native software … using Kubernetes Understanding of systems design and Open Source components. If you have knowledge of building virtual machines - Virtual servers, virtual networking or network programming - that's a plus... but definitely not needed! If this sounds like you, feel free to apply and I can run through more details more »
Posted:

Lead Software Engineer

Greater London, England, United Kingdom
Burns Sheehan
Lead Software Engineer | Distributed Systems | Sustainable Cloud Native Platform 💸Up to £120,000 per annum plus bonus plus stock 🏠Central London office 🖱️Golang, Rust, C, Kubernetes, Linux, Cloud Native, Distributed systems... Are you a Lead Software Engineer with extensive knowledge of building distributed systems? Looking … looking for in a Lead Software Engineer: Tech agnostic but preferable experience working with Golang, Rust or C/C++. In-depth knowledge of distributed systems, building solutions at scale where performance, reliability and availability are key considerations. Confident in leading the definition and creation of solutions to … complex challenges. Experience working on software infrastructure or building Cloud native software using Kubernetes. Understanding of systems design and Open Source components. If you have knowledge of building virtual machines - Virtual servers, virtual networking or network programming - that's a plus... but definitely not needed! If this sounds like more »
Posted:
Distributed Systems
England
10th Percentile
£48,250
25th Percentile
£62,500
Median
£82,500
75th Percentile
£115,000
90th Percentile
£147,500